What is Hoarding and Why Does It Happen?

Before diving into hoarding cleanup, it is essential to understand hoarding itself. Hoarding is more than just clutter. It’s a psychological condition where an individual feels compelled to save items, regardless of their value, to the extent that it compromises living spaces, safety, and daily functioning.

Common causes of hoarding include:

  • Trauma or loss
  • Anxiety disorders
  • Depression
  • OCD tendencies
  • Fear of letting go

Regardless of the cause, hoarding cleanup is rarely just about cleaning – it is about restoring dignity and reclaiming one’s life and living environment.

The Risks of Hoarding: More Than Just Clutter

Professional hoarding cleanup is critical because hoarding poses significant risks, including:

1. Fire Hazards

Stacks of paper, cardboard, and debris create a fire risk that endangers the residents and neighbors.

2. Structural Damage

Excessive items can strain the structural integrity of floors and walls, especially in older Gallatin homes.

3. Pest Infestation

Rodents and insects thrive in hoarded environments, increasing health risks.

4. Blocked Exits

Hoarding often blocks pathways and exits, posing safety risks during emergencies.

5. Mold, Mildew, and Biohazards

Hidden spills or organic waste can foster dangerous mold growth and unsanitary conditions.

Average Cost for Hoarder Cleanup in Gallatin

One common concern is the average cost of hoarder cleanup. Pricing varies depending on:

  • The extent of hoarding
  • Biohazard presence
  • Structural damage
  • Size of the property

On average, hoarding cleanup services range between $2,000 and above. Extreme hoarding cleanup with biohazard remediation or structural repairs can exceed this range. PuroClean of Hendersonville provides transparent, detailed estimates and flexible scheduling to ease this financial decision.

FAQs About Hoarding Cleanup

What is included in hoarding cleanup services?

Hoarding cleanup includes sorting, decluttering, hazardous waste cleanup, deep cleaning, odor removal, and minor repairs as needed.

How long does hoarding cleanup take?

Depending on the extent, it can take one day to several days. Severe hoarding or biohazard conditions may require a week or more.
